I wanted a baseboard B5 valveholder, so decided to make one. This is made from two pieces of brown acrylic sheet cut into circles with a round saw. The sockets are brass tubes from a model shop with the top ends opened out a bit by getting them red hot, putting a centre punch in them and giving a sharp tap with a hammer. I then glued them into the holes with Gorilla superglue. The five connection bolts had five thin wires soldered to them before fitting in the holder. The wires were wrapped round the tubes underneath, and soldered. The tubes protrude beneath the valveholder, but this is accommodated by drilling a large round hole where the valveholder is to be fitted, using a wood-cutting bit!
Very pleased with the result.
